Ggit.SubmoduleUpdateOptions

g GObject.Object GObject.Object Ggit.SubmoduleUpdateOptions Ggit.SubmoduleUpdateOptions GObject.Object->Ggit.SubmoduleUpdateOptions

Subclasses:None

Methods

Inherited:GObject.Object (37)
Structs:GObject.ObjectClass (5)
class new ()
  get_checkout_options ()
  get_fetch_options ()
  set_checkout_options (checkout_options)
  set_fetch_options (fetch_options)

Virtual Methods

Inherited:GObject.Object (7)

Properties

Name Type Flags Short Description
checkout-options Ggit.CheckoutOptions r/w Checkout options
fetch-options Ggit.FetchOptions r/w Fetch options

Signals

Inherited:GObject.Object (1)

Fields

Inherited:GObject.Object (1)
Name Type Access Description
parent_instance GObject.Object r  

Class Details

class Ggit.SubmoduleUpdateOptions(**kwargs)
Bases:GObject.Object
Abstract:No
Structure:Ggit.SubmoduleUpdateOptionsClass

Represents options for a submodule update.

classmethod new()
Returns:a Ggit.SubmoduleUpdateOptions or None.
Return type:Ggit.SubmoduleUpdateOptions or None

Creates a new submodule options object.

get_checkout_options()
Returns:a Ggit.CheckoutOptions or None.
Return type:Ggit.CheckoutOptions or None

Get the checkout options.

get_fetch_options()
Return type:Ggit.FetchOptions
set_checkout_options(checkout_options)
Parameters:checkout_options (Ggit.CheckoutOptions or None) – a Ggit.CheckoutOptions.

Set the checkout options.

set_fetch_options(fetch_options)
Parameters:fetch_options (Ggit.FetchOptions or None) – a Ggit.FetchOptions.

Sets the fetch options.

Property Details

Ggit.SubmoduleUpdateOptions.props.checkout_options
Name:checkout-options
Type:Ggit.CheckoutOptions
Default Value:None
Flags:READABLE, WRITABLE

Checkout options

Ggit.SubmoduleUpdateOptions.props.fetch_options
Name:fetch-options
Type:Ggit.FetchOptions
Default Value:None
Flags:READABLE, WRITABLE

Fetch options